SN74HC04PW Equivalent & Substitute Parts
Part Overview
The SN74HC04PW is a 6-channel inverter logic IC manufactured by Texas Instruments in 14-TSSOP surface mount packaging. This part is discontinued at DiGi Electronics but remains available through inventory channels. The SN74HC04PW performs basic logic inversion functions across six independent channels, making it fundamental to digital circuit design where signal inversion is required. Finding equivalent and substitute parts is necessary due to the discontinued status and to identify functionally compatible alternatives from active manufacturers.

Key Parameters
| Parameter | Value |
|---|---|
| Logic Type | Inverter |
| Number of Circuits | 6 |
| Number of Inputs | 1 |
| Voltage Supply Range | 2V to 6V |
| Operating Temperature Range | -40°C to 85°C |
| Package Type | 14-TSSOP (0.173", 4.40mm Width) |
| Mounting Type | Surface Mount |
| Max Propagation Delay | 16ns @ 6V, 50pF |
| Current Output High/Low | 5.2mA / 5.2mA |
| RoHS Status | ROHS3 Compliant |
Substitute Part Grouping Explanation
Substitution for the SN74HC04PW is determined by strict equivalence across the following parameters: logic type (inverter), number of circuits (6), number of inputs (1), package type (14-TSSOP), mounting type (surface mount), and compliance certifications (ROHS3, REACH Unaffected). Substitute parts must maintain identical or superior electrical performance within the specified voltage supply range (2V to 6V) and output current ratings (5.2mA minimum for both high and low states).
Substitutes are grouped into two categories:
Category 1: Direct 74HC04 Equivalents – Parts maintaining identical specifications including operating temperature range (-40°C to 85°C), quiescent current (2µA), and propagation delay (16ns @ 6V, 50pF). These provide pin-for-pin compatibility with no design modifications required.
Category 2: Enhanced 74HC04 Variants – Parts with improved specifications such as extended operating temperature range (-40°C to 125°C), reduced propagation delay (13-15ns @ 6V, 50pF), or superior quiescent current performance (1µA). These are fully compatible substitutes with performance advantages.
Category 3: 74HCU04 Series – Parts using the unbuffered 74HCU04 logic family with different input logic level thresholds (0.3V to 1.2V low, 1.7V to 4.8V high versus 0.5V to 1.8V low, 1.5V to 4.2V high for standard 74HC04). These require circuit-level verification of input signal compatibility but maintain identical package, pin count, and output specifications.
Parameter Comparison
| Part Number | Manufacturer | Product Status | Voltage Supply | Operating Temp | Quiescent Current (Max) | Propagation Delay @ 6V, 50pF | Output Current High/Low | Packaging |
|---|---|---|---|---|---|---|---|---|
| SN74HC04PW | Texas Instruments | Discontinued | 2V – 6V | -40°C to 85°C | 2µA | 16ns | 5.2mA / 5.2mA | Tube |
| SN74HC04PWR | Texas Instruments | Active | 2V – 6V | -40°C to 85°C | 2µA | 16ns | 5.2mA / 5.2mA | Cut Tape & Digi-Reel |
| MC74HC04ADTR2G | onsemi | Active | 2V – 6V | -55°C to 125°C | 1µA | 13ns | 5.2mA / 5.2mA | Tape & Reel |
| MM74HC04MTCX | onsemi | Active | 2V – 6V | -40°C to 85°C | 2µA | 16ns | 5.2mA / 5.2mA | Tape & Reel |
| 74HC04PW,118 | Nexperia USA Inc. | Active | 2V – 6V | -40°C to 125°C | 2µA | 14ns | 5.2mA / 5.2mA | Tape & Reel |
| 74HC04T14-13 | Diodes Incorporated | Active | 2V – 6V | -40°C to 125°C | 20µA | 15ns | 5.2mA / 5.2mA | Tape & Reel |
| 74HCU04T14-13 | Diodes Incorporated | Active | 2V – 6V | -40°C to 125°C | 20µA | 12ns | 5.2mA / 5.2mA | Tape & Reel |
| MM74HCU04MTCX | onsemi | Active | 2V – 6V | -40°C to 85°C | 2µA | 14ns | 5.2mA / 7.8mA | Cut Tape & Digi-Reel |
Engineering Selection Recommendations
For direct replacement with no design changes: Select SN74HC04PWR (Texas Instruments, active status) or MM74HC04MTCX (onsemi, active status). Both maintain identical electrical specifications to the SN74HC04PW with matching operating temperature range and propagation delay. SN74HC04PWR is available in Cut Tape & Digi-Reel packaging; MM74HC04MTCX is available in Tape & Reel.
For improved performance with extended temperature range: Select MC74HC04ADTR2G (onsemi) or 74HC04PW,118 (Nexperia USA Inc.). Both are active products with ROHS3 compliance. MC74HC04ADTR2G offers superior quiescent current (1µA) and faster propagation delay (13ns). 74HC04PW,118 provides extended operating temperature to 125°C with 14ns propagation delay.
For cost-optimized alternatives: 74HC04T14-13 (Diodes Incorporated) and 74HCU04T14-13 (Diodes Incorporated) are active products with extended temperature range to 125°C. Note that 74HCU04T14-13 uses the unbuffered logic family with different input thresholds and requires verification of input signal compatibility in the target circuit.
For applications requiring higher output current on low state: MM74HCU04MTCX (onsemi) provides 7.8mA output low current versus standard 5.2mA, with active product status and ROHS3 compliance.
All recommended substitutes maintain ROHS3 compliance, REACH Unaffected status, and identical 14-TSSOP package dimensions. Selection should prioritize active product status and availability from the specified packaging format required by your assembly process.
Frequently Asked Questions (FAQ)
Q: Can I use 74HCU04 series parts as direct replacements for 74HC04?
A: 74HCU04 parts are pin-compatible and functionally equivalent inverters in the same 14-TSSOP package. However, they use unbuffered logic with different input logic level thresholds (0.3V to 1.2V low, 1.7V to 4.8V high) compared to standard 74HC04 (0.5V to 1.8V low, 1.5V to 4.2V high). Verify that your input signal voltage levels are compatible with the 74HCU04 thresholds before substitution.
Q: What is the difference between SN74HC04PW and SN74HC04PWR?
A: Both are Texas Instruments 74HC04 inverters with identical electrical specifications. The primary difference is packaging format: SN74HC04PW is supplied in Tube packaging (now discontinued), while SN74HC04PWR is supplied in Cut Tape & Digi-Reel format (active status). Electrical performance and pin configuration are identical.
Q: Are all substitute parts ROHS3 compliant?
A: Yes. All substitute parts listed maintain ROHS3 compliance and REACH Unaffected status, matching the compliance profile of the original SN74HC04PW.
Q: Which substitute offers the fastest propagation delay?
A: 74HCU04T14-13 (Diodes Incorporated) provides the fastest propagation delay at 12ns @ 6V, 50pF. MC74HC04ADTR2G (onsemi) offers 13ns. Both are active products with full compliance certifications.
Q: Can I substitute based on operating temperature range alone?
A: No. While extended temperature range (-40°C to 125°C) is available in MC74HC04ADTR2G, 74HC04PW,118, 74HC04T14-13, and 74HCU04T14-13, substitution must also verify matching logic type, circuit count (6 channels), input count (1 per channel), package type (14-TSSOP), and output current specifications (minimum 5.2mA for both high and low states).
Q: What packaging formats are available for active substitutes?
A: Active substitutes are available in three packaging formats: Cut Tape & Digi-Reel (SN74HC04PWR, MM74HCU04MTCX), Tape & Reel (MC74HC04ADTR2G, 74HC04PW,118, 74HC04T14-13, 74HCU04T14-13), and Tube (original SN74HC04PW, now discontinued). Verify your assembly process requirements before selecting a substitute.
